5G to Contribute Over $7.5tn to Global GDP by 2030 – Report

By 2030, 5G-related initiatives will contribute over $7.5 trillion to the global gross domestic product (GDP).
This is according to Dimitris Mavrakis, research director of ABI Research, highlighting the impact of 5G technologies on the global economy, businesses and consumers across the globe.

Mavrakis was speaking at the Huawei 5G+, Better World Summit, where various operators and industry partners shared their view on how 5G applications can drive significant business and industry efficiency.
He noted that low latency, high-speed 5G connectivity has opened infinite opportunities for businesses, resulting in productivity gains and operational efficiency, boosting economic growth by over $7.5 trillion in the next decade – compared to the $5.1 trillion 4G contributed in 2019.
While 5G will drive future businesses across all sectors worldwide, Mavrakis said it is likely to be most beneficial to the commercial sector.
“We expect that 5G will transform businesses in the same way 4G transformed consumers. However, it could take several years for the manufacturing world to adopt the technology.”
With some governments aiming to establish themselves as global leaders in trialling 5G projects, Mavrakis highlighted government’s role in creating opportunities through 5G, such as in the provisioning of free 5G spectrum and the reduction in taxation of carriers.
Governments, he added, could provide opportunities for 5G to flourish within their countries by prioritising efficient usage of public and private digital infrastructure and establishing a national approach to building skills in 5G.
According to a report by Orange Business Services, 5G is set to have a profound effect on countries’ economic performance and GDP. In 2016, mobile technologies and services generated 4.4% of GDP globally, equating to about $3.3 trillion in economic value. In 2020, this has been estimated to grow to over $4.2 trillion, or 4.9% of the global GDP.
Advisory firm PwC forecasts that fast, intelligent Internet connectivity enabled by 5G technology is expected to create approximately $3.6 trillion in economic output and 22.3 million jobs by 2035 in the global 5G value chain alone. This will translate into global economic value across industries of $13.2 trillion, notes PwC. The manufacturing, information and communications, wholesale and retail, public services and construction sectors will be those expected to have the highest reliance on 5G technologies.

Clydestone Ghana Sues MTN Over Mobile Money

Clydestone Ghana Plc has filed a writ of summons and statement of claim against MTN Ghana, MTN Group Limited and Mobile Money Fintech Limited, alleging unauthorized use of its intellectual property.

The company announced the court action at the Ghana Stock Exchange, confirming proceedings in the Commercial Division of the High Court of Ghana.
The case relates to work commissioned in 2007 that Clydestone alleges was later used without authorisation or compensation.
Clydestone said the claim involves proprietary intellectual property, confidential commercial information and operational methodology developed during the engagement. The company is seeking declarations, damages and equitable remedies.
In a statement, Clydestone said MTN Ghana engaged it in 2007 to develop a commercial and operational framework for a mobile money business.
“The work was developed and delivered by the company’s founder and Group CEO, Paul Jacquaye, and included a full mobile money ecosystem covering the commercial model, operational architecture, implementation methodology and business case.”
Clydestone said the work was commissioned on the understanding that a non-disclosure agreement and memorandum of understanding would be signed.
It alleges these agreements were not finalised despite repeated requests.
The company further alleges MTN Ghana later used its proprietary work and methodology without authorisation or compensation, including in MTN Mobile Money Ghana and other markets.
Clydestone said the alleged use has continued since the launch of MTN Mobile Money Ghana in 2009.
“The wrongful use of that work has been ongoing since 2009. What has changed is the availability of independently verifiable information that documents its scale and commercial significance,” the company said.
It cited the GSMA State of the Industry Report on Mobile Money 2026 and MTN Ghana’s 2025 annual report as evidence of the platform’s scale.
According to Clydestone, the reports show approximately 19.3 million active users and annual revenue of about GHS 6.0 billion ($516m).
The company said it reviewed its records following these publications and concluded there were sufficient grounds to initiate legal proceedings.
It added that it has received no payment or acknowledgement for the work since December 2007, and that pre-action correspondence in 2026 received no substantive response.
“The Board of Directors has unanimously authorised the commencement of these proceedings,” the company said.
Jacquaye said: “This case is about accountability for commissioned intellectual property.
“When independent publications in 2025 and 2026 revealed the scale of the mobile money business, we reviewed all documentation relating to the original engagement and concluded these proceedings were necessary.”
MTN Group Limited, named as a defendant, had not commented at the time of publication.

Operators Divert Rollout Equipment to Fix Sabotaged Delta Assets Amid Spares Shortage

In a development that underscores the fragile state of Nigeria’s telecommunications grid, an incident of infrastructure vandalism in Delta State has severely disrupted network connectivity, leaving thousands of subscribers stranded.

The breach, where a robber attacked the sites, occurred at an IHS-managed telecom node in the ASB region on July 8, 2026, immediately knocking 33 base stations offline across 2G, 3G, and 4G spectrums.
The situation in the region escalated drastically by morning when a separate fibre-optic cable cut severed primary transmission lines. Because the compromised node serves as a critical fibre convergence point, the secondary fibre cut triggered a cascading failure.
This secondary disruption ballooned the number of dark sites from 33 to 103, temporarily paralysing digital communications, banking, and commerce in the affected communities.
Industry sources reveal that the financial and logistical toll of such incidents is becoming unsustainable for Mobile Network Operators (MNOs).
Currently, network providers are utilising 20 per cent more spare parts than initially budgeted for the fiscal year.
This unpredictable depletion of technical reserves has stripped operators of their supply buffers, making inventory management and financial forecasting increasingly difficult for telecom executives.
Consequently, engineering teams have been forced to cannibalise materials originally designated for network expansion and new site rollouts just to perform emergency restorations on the damaged sites.
This diversion of resources significantly delays the rollout of new infrastructure, stifling the nation’s broader broadband penetration targets and stalling anticipated revenue generation for the telecom companies.
The Nigerian Communications Commission (NCC) recently noted an average of 1,744 weekly attacks on telecom infrastructure nationwide, including over 1,100 fibre cuts.
As operators endure protracted back-and-forth negotiations with insurance firms to cover these sudden hardware losses, stakeholders are intensifying calls for the strict enforcement of the Federal Government’s recent designation of telecom assets as Critical National Information Infrastructure (CNII) to safeguard Quality of Service (QoS).
